What Is Ansys optiSLang?

With support for design of experiments, sensitivity analysis, metamodels, and uncertainty quantification, Ansys optiSLang is a leading solution for process integration and robust design optimization (RDO) that helps teams explore vast design spaces efficiently.

  • Automates CAE workflows

  • Connects diverse simulation tools

  • Uses advanced algorithms to identify optimal & reliable design configurations

Without optiSLang With optiSLang
Parameters Manual parameter changes and spreadsheet-based tracking Centralized definition of parameters, constraints, and objectives across all models
Workflow Isolated solver runs with disconnected workflows Automated, integrated workflows connecting multiple solvers and tools
Exploration Trial-and-error parametric sweeps Structured Design of Experiments (DOE) and advanced optimization algorithms
Insight Limited visibility into variable influence Built-in sensitivity analysis identifying key performance drivers
Robustness Optimized for peak performance only Robust design optimization accounting for variability and uncertainty
Efficiency Slow iteration cycles and higher risk of redesign Faster convergence with data-backed decisions and quantified confidence
